Python3实现从文件中读取指定行的方法
2015-05-22 11:57
417 查看
# Python的标准库linecache模块非常适合这个任务 import linecache the_line = linecache.getline('d:/FreakOut.cpp', 222) print (the_line) # linecache读取并缓存文件中所有的文本, # 若文件很大,而只读一行,则效率低下。 # 可显示使用循环, 注意enumerate从0开始计数,而line_number从1开始 def getline(the_file_path, line_number): if line_number < 1: return '' for cur_line_number, line in enumerate(open(the_file_path, 'rU')): if cur_line_number == line_number-1: return line return '' the_line = linecache.getline('d:/FreakOut.cpp', 222) print (the_line)
希望本文所述对大家的Python程序设计有所帮助。
您可能感兴趣的文章:
- Python实现对excel文件列表值进行统计的方法
- python读取excel指定列数据并写入到新的excel方法
- Python进行数据提取的方法总结
- 用python读写excel的方法
- 解决Python pandas df 写入excel 出现的问题
- Python3使用pandas模块读写excel操作示例
- Python基于xlrd模块操作Excel的方法示例
- 使用python将大量数据导出到Excel中的小技巧分享
- 利用python对Excel中的特定数据提取并写入新表的方法
- python xlsxwriter创建excel图表的方法
- python操作excel的包(openpyxl、xlsxwriter)
- python操作excel的方法(xlsxwriter包的使用)
- 使用Python处理Excel表格的简单方法
- Python实现读取txt文件并转换为excel的方法示例
- python3读取excel文件只提取某些行某些列的值方法
相关文章推荐
- Python3实现从文件中读取指定行的方法
- Java实现从jar包中读取指定文件的方法
- Python实现读取TXT文件数据并存进内置数据库SQLite3的方法
- Android开发实现读取Assets下文件及文件写入存储卡的方法
- Android开发实现读取assets目录下db文件的方法示例
- Python按行读取文件的简单实现方法
- Python按行读取文件的简单实现方法
- Java 实现读取文件指定行
- thinkPHP+PHPExcel实现读取文件日期的方法(含时分秒)
- thinkPHP+PHPExcel实现读取文件日期的方法(含时分秒)
- php 读取输出其他文件的实现方法
- 批处理集锦——(6)【转】批处理实现全盘搜索指定文件获取其完整路径方法大全
- C#实现读取指定盘符硬盘序列号的方法
- python计算文件的行数和读取某一行内容的实现方法
- QT实现图库程序(一)读取指定目录下的所有文件
- php实现远程网络文件下载到服务器指定目录(方法一)
- Shell实现读取ini格式配置文件方法
- AOP实现方法的日志记录,并输出到指定文件
- 【转载】python计算文件的行数和读取某一行内容的实现方法
- 通过shell脚本实现从文件中读取数据的几种方法